LENEXA, Kan., 25 August 2021 / PRNewswire-PRWeb / – The second largest school district in Kansas selected WANRack ™, a national wide area fiber optic network (WAN) provider, to modernize its broadband infrastructure. WANRack has already started construction of a 52.4 mile fiber optic network for Olathe Public schools, which has the largest computer network of any other entity in the Kansas City Metropolitan area. The project will connect more than 75 district sites and bring network speeds of up to 100 Gbps to the 35,000 students and staff in the district.

After a comprehensive bidding process that attracted proposals from a wide variety of suppliers, Olathe Public schools awarded the three contracts – for WAN, Internet access and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) services – to WANRack. The new private fiber network is capable of delivering 100 Gpbs, more than ten times the speed of the network it replaces. In addition, the new WANRack network guarantees huge cost savings for the district, reducing monthly charges by more than 50% at current network bandwidth levels.

The cost savings over the current service provider will continue to accelerate as the district takes advantage of the higher network speeds. In addition, the WANRack solution eliminates hundreds of thousands of dollars in expenses that increasing bandwidth with the current provider would have incurred.

"The WANRack network is incredibly faster and considerably more cost effective than anything we have been able to achieve or even imagine before," said Matt Vrlenich, chief technology officer of Olathe Public schools. "I strongly recommend all districts to consider upgrading to a WANRack network. I cannot speak highly of the company, its expertise and the superiority of its offer.

Olathe The public schools are home to 36 elementary schools, ten middle schools and five high schools, as well as data centers, sports facilities and additional learning centers spread across the cities of Olathe, Land park and Lenexa. The district has experienced 55 consecutive years of enrollment growth. The WANRack fiber network ensures a scalable strategy that can stay ahead of future networking demands, allowing the district to increase bandwidth as needed with little or no additional expense.

“We are excited to expand our impact in the Midwest and enhance the educational experience for students of Olathe public schools, "said Rob oyler, founder and CEO of WANRack. “This network is the last network Olathe Public schools will always need it, and it literally lays the foundation for WANRack to provide high capacity Internet and VoIP services for any district in the greater Kansas City subway station.”

WANRack is currently operating in 23 states. The company’s robust fiber optic networks cross the country, from Florida To Washington state, and Arizona To Connecticut. The WANRack management team has built and delivered over 200 fiber optic WANs since 2005.

Some of the major trends seen in the market include the growing demand for compact and quiet solutions, the growing need for environmentally friendly data center cooling solutions, and adoption in low density data centers.

Global Immersion Cooling Market: Market Dynamics

The increase in the number of large-scale data centers is the main factor driving the market as large-scale data centers are widely used in different industries to boost memory, network infrastructure, compute capacity or storage resources. The growing need for cost-effective cooling solutions, the increasing density of server racks and the growing need for environmentally friendly data center cooling solutions are the major factors driving the growth of the market.

For example, the US government’s Federal Energy Management Program (FEMP) encourages organizations and agencies to improve energy efficiency in data centers through its Center of Expertise (CoE). As cooling systems account for 30-60% of power consumption in data centers, operators are focusing on implementing advanced cooling technologies to maintain efficiency.

On the other hand, it reduces noise in server rooms. Further, immersion cooling prevents IT equipment from environmental contaminants such as dust and sulfur from further fueling the market growth.

By type

Single-phase immersion cooling segment dominates the market in 2020

The single phase immersion cooling segment generated huge revenue in 2020 and gained prominence during the forecast period as it is a simple and efficient method of cooling components, devices and sub -electric systems. Single-phase immersion cooling offers significantly lower initial costs due to its simple design and lower cooling costs.

By geography

The North America region is the world market leader

North America is expected to experience huge demand during the forecast period due to the presence of numerous data centers and the growing demand for advanced technologies in the region. As chip densities increase, the data center faces serious cooling issues and hence it adopts immersion cooling as it is ideal for high density data centers. The United States and Canada are the main consumers of immersion cooling in this region.

PORTLAND, PORTLAND, OR, UNITED STATES, August 25, 2021 /EINPresswire.com/ – The main growth drivers of the software-defined networks market are CSP’s investment in SDN technology to automate network infrastructure, significant reduction in CAPEX and OPEX, increasing demand for cloud services, data center consolidation and server virtualization, increasing demand enterprise mobility to improve the productivity of field services.

Increasing adoption of cloud computing, increasing investment in virtualization of software-defined network functions to reduce capital expenditure are the major factors driving the market growth.

The global software-defined networks market generated $ 9.99 billion in 2019 and is expected to generate $ 72.63 billion by 2027, with a CAGR of 28.2% from 2020 to 2027.

Based on industry vertical, the information and telecommunications technology segment accounted for the highest market share, contributing more than two-fifths of the global software-defined network market in 2019, and is expected to maintain its dominant share by 2027. This is attributed to huge data generated by IoT, increased need to improve agility and innovation, and increased need to improve employee collaboration. However, the consumer goods and retail segment is expected to grow at the highest CAGR of 32.9% during the forecast period. This is due to the increasing demand for potable water from the residential sector and other municipal sector applications.

On a component basis, the solutions segment contributed the largest market share in 2019, accounting for over three-fifths of the global software-defined networks market, and is expected to maintain its leading status during the forecast period. . This is attributed to the increased adoption of software-defined network solutions by enterprises and communication service providers to dramatically speed up the delivery time of new applications and services. However, the service segment is expected to post the highest CAGR of 30.90% from 2020 to 2027. This is due to the growth in demand from companies to develop strategy for networks.

Download a sample report (get complete information in PDF format – 322 pages) at: https://www.alliedmarketresearch.com/request-sample/218

Based on region, North America region held the largest share of the global software-defined networking market, contributing nearly two-fifths of the total share in 2019, and will maintain its leadership position during the period. forecast. This is due to the increase in the adoption of advanced technologies in various industry verticals, the increase in the adoption of cloud computing and mobility solutions, and the increased need for management of network for heavy network traffic. On the other hand,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to post the fastest CAGR of 32.60% from 2020 to 2027. This is attributed to the increase in the number of start-ups and the ramping up of implementation. implementation of new and advanced technologies such as virtualization services and mobility solutions among the work system of companies in this region.

I was recently on hold for customer service at a large website and the more I listened to their pre-recorded messages the more I realized that the standard on-hold customer service verbiage was the worst of the weasel wording. Here are the 9 worst offenders and what they really mean:

1. “For your convenience …”

Translation: “We will greatly inconvenience you in order to increase our profit margins by making you wait.”

2. “Please stay on the line and we’ll be with you shortly.”

Translation: “Grab a sandwich and fire up YouTube in a side window because you’re going to be waiting a long, long time.”

3. “Due to an unusually high call volume …”

Translation: “Due to the fact that we are unwilling to staff customer service …”

4. “Your call is important to us.”

Translation: “You are a costly nuisance to us.”

5. “Our representatives help clients like you.”

Translation: “The only person we have assigned to customer service is at lunch.”

6. “Your feedback is important to us.”

Translation: "We want you to report the service reps if they’re not afraid when you yell at them so that we can stiffen them up, when it comes to the salary review. “

7. “You can find help faster on our website.”

Translation: "Please leave before we have to pay someone to help you; we’d rather you waste your time pretending that our ‘AI’ can get you a useful answer. “

8. “We look forward to exceeding your expectations.”

Translation: “We are actively trying, through our service policies and long wait times, to lower your expectations to the point where you’ll be grateful if you end up talking to something with a pulse.”
